How Tardies Work
Tardy/Late To School
All students are required to arrive to school on time and be in their first period class, prepared and in full uniform, when the bell sounds at 7:43. Those students who are late must report to the cafeteria lobby and sign in with the Parent Liaison. Students entering school after 7:43 will report to the Discipline Office to sign in. A parent/guardian call or note, notifying the school of a student's tardiness is required. Tardies result in the loss of valuable instructional time disrupts the educational process when students enter class late and any class work missed must be made up under the same circumstances as any class absence.
- Students entering school between 7:43 and 9:00 am will be considered Tardy(T)
- Students entering school between 9:00 and 11:00am will be considered Tardy(TA)
- Students entering school after 11:00am will be considered Absent-Tardy (AT)
When a student accumulates 3 tardy-absent TA it will be considered a full absent and will be added to their accrued absences for the year.
Consistent Tardies will result in the following:
- 6 tardies - 30 min After School Recovery Time (ASRT) - parent notified
- 10 tardies - 2 hour After School Recovery Time (ASRT) - parent meeting
- 12 tardies - loss of driving privileges - parent meeting ● 15 tardies - Saturday After School Recovery Time (ASRT) - parent notified
- 16+tardies- Administrative Intervention
